The Door Gasket Assembly is an OEM part for LG refrigerators. It is a comprehensive kit that includes the gaskets that line the door frame. These gaskets create an air tight seal when the refrigerator door is closed, helping to maintain cool temperatures inside and conserve energy. The Right Side Drawer Rail Guide is an OEM part for LG refrigerators. This component is designed to support and guide the movement of the refrigerator's drawers, allowing them to slide in and out smoothly. It is mounted on the right side of the drawer compartment and helps ensure the proper alignment and stability of the drawer.

Causes of a bad drawer rail guide can include regular wear and tear from frequent use, physical damage from heavy or improperly loaded drawers, and deterioration over time due to temperature changes within the refrigerator.

The Icemaker Assembly is an OEM part for LG refrigerators. It is responsible for producing and storing ice within the freezer compartment.
You should replace the icemaker assembly if it becomes faulty. Causes of a bad icemaker assembly can include wear and tear from regular use, mineral buildup from hard water, or failures in the mechanical or electronic components. These issues can lead to inconsistent ice production or complete failure to produce ice.

The Drawer Cover is an OEM part for LG refrigerators. It serves as a protective cover for the refrigerator's crisper drawers, providing a barrier that helps maintain optimal humidity levels and freshness for stored fruits and vegetables. The shelf measures approximately 19" in depth and 26" in width. This product does not include glass. As per the manufacturer's note, the original center support is not compatible with the updated crisper cover.
You should replace the drawer cover if it becomes cracked, broken, or warped. Common causes of damage include placing heavy items on top of the cover, accidental impacts, or normal wear and tear over time, which can compromise its structural integrity and functionality.

The Gasket Holder is an OEM replacement part for LG refrigerators. It is inside the freezer door and functions to securely seal in cold air. The holder provides a mounting point and compression fit for the door gasket, preventing air leakage along the perimeter.

Over time, the holder's mounting points can warp or weaken from repeated opening and closing of the freezer door. This allows for gasket movement and compromised sealing.

The Gasket Holder is an OEM part for LG refrigerators. This part holds the door gasket in place, ensuring a tight seal around the refrigerator or freezer door.
Over time, the gasket holder can become warped or damaged due to frequent use, temperature fluctuations, or accidental impacts.

The Holder Gasket is an OEM part for LG refrigerators. This gasket creates a tight seal between the holder and the refrigerator's interior, preventing air leaks and maintaining optimal cooling efficiency.
Common causes of a bad gasket include wear and tear over time, exposure to extreme temperatures, or accidental damage during maintenance or cleaning.
